Product Overview
Dimethylchlorosilane, identified by CAS number 1066-35-9, stands as a cornerstone compound in the realm of organosilicon chemistry. This versatile chemical intermediate is primarily utilized as a fundamental building block for the synthesis of advanced silicone materials. Our manufacturing process ensures that each batch meets rigorous industrial standards, delivering a colorless or light yellow transparent liquid with exceptional consistency. As a key reagent, it facilitates the creation of complex molecular structures required in high-performance polymer applications.
The compound is recognized for its reactivity and efficiency in hydrosilylation reactions. It serves as a vital precursor in the production of silicone surfactants, which are essential for stabilizing formulations in various industrial sectors. Furthermore, its role as an end-capping agent for alpha and omega hydrogen-silicon-terminated organosilicon polymers underscores its importance in controlling molecular weight and functionality in silicone rubber and resin production.

Industrial Applications
The utility of Dimethylchlorosilane extends across multiple domains of chemical manufacturing. It is extensively employed as a hydrosilylating agent for alkynes, enabling precise organic synthesis pathways. In the plastics and resin industry, it acts as a modifier to enhance the performance characteristics of polyolefins, polyacrylates, polyamides, and polyimides. By introducing silicone functionalities, manufacturers can achieve improved thermal stability, water resistance, and surface properties in their final products.
Additionally, this chemical is indispensable for preparing silicone surfactants used in foam control and emulsification processes. Its ability to modify polyester, polyurethane, and epoxy systems makes it a valuable asset for formulators seeking to optimize material performance. Whether used in dendrimer synthesis or as a starting material for specialized coatings, Dimethylchlorosilane provides the necessary reactivity and structural integrity required for demanding applications.
Storage and Safety Handling
Safety is paramount when handling Dimethylchlorosilane due to its classification as a Dangerous Good Class 4.3 substance, which emits flammable gases upon contact with water. Storage facilities must be cool, dry, and well-ventilated, maintaining temperatures between 0 degrees Celsius and 15 degrees Celsius for optimal stability. The product should remain in its original unopened container away from fire sources, oxidants, alkalis, and alcohols.
Transportation requires strict adherence to hazardous material regulations. Vehicles must be equipped with appropriate fire-fighting equipment, and mechanical tools prone to sparking are strictly forbidden during loading and unloading. Mixing with edible chemicals or incompatible substances is prohibited. During summer months, transport should occur during cooler periods to prevent sunlight exposure.
